Original Description
Sir Thomas Lawrence’s Portrait of William Lock (1790) exudes an air of refined elegance and introspective charm, capturing the sitter’s dignified yet approachable demeanor. Painted during Lawrence’s ascent as Britain’s premier portraitist, the work showcases his signature fluid brushwork and mastery of texture, particularly in the delicate lace cravat and softly modeled face. Lock, a wealthy art connoisseur and friend of the artist, is rendered with psychological depth—his thoughtful gaze and relaxed pose convey both intelligence and warmth. The muted yet rich palette of earthy browns and creams, paired with subtle lighting, creates a sense of quiet sophistication. This portrait exemplifies late 18th-century British portraiture, bridging the grandeur of Joshua Reynolds and the emerging Romantic sensibility. Its historical significance lies in Lawrence’s ability to blend aristocratic poise with intimate humanity, securing his legacy as a successor to Reynolds’ artistic mantle.
